Most of you know I am a high school student attempting to obtain college scholarships. Today, I took a HUGE step towards that end. Today I got my ACT results for my last test. For those that do not know, the ACT is similar to the SAT in that it allows you to qualify for college entrance. It is scored on a scale of 1 to 36, with 36 being perfect, a score that is seen by less than a tenth of a percent of students.

I pulled off a 33. This puts me in the 99th percentile. More importantly (to me, though my priorities are a little goofy,) that also gives me the highest score my school has ever had, and I think, possibly, the highest in my county as well.

English- 35
Math- 27
Reading- 34
Science- 36 (Perfect score, can I get a w00t-w00t.)

Congratulations Jacob...that is a great score. I believe some colleges not only look at your best overall score, but your best combination of subject scores. Therefore, study up on the math section and take it again and see if you can get that score up toward the rest of the subjects. Every point improvement helps you climb up the admission list for whatever school you're looking at.

33 is a terrific score though and should definitely get you in the discussion for serious scholarship money.
